Frequently Asked Questions

What is the population and demographic makeup of Colony?

The total population of Colony is approximately 101. The largest age group is 35-64 year olds. This demographic data is sourced from the U.S. Census Bureau.

Is Colony walkable and transit-friendly?

Based on local geographic data, Colony has an amenity and walkability score of 30/100 and a transit score of 79/100. This indicates the area is mostly car-dependent for daily errands and commuting.

Do more people rent or own homes in Colony?

The housing market in Colony is predominantly driven by homeowners, with 83% of housing units being owner-occupied and 17% being renter-occupied.
